Board fixes calculator's model for HSC candidates

DHAKA, June 16, 2025 (BSS) - The Board has decided to allow the use of seven 
models of non-programmable scientific calculators during the HSC (Higher 
Secondary Certificate) exams, scheduled to be held on June 26, for 
candidates. 

This decision applies to the upcoming exams and allows students to utilize 
ordinary calculators at the exam centers. 

Regarding this, an instruction has been sent to the central secretary and 
other concerned persons.

The information was revealed today in a notification signed by examination 
controller of the Dhaka Secondary and Higher Secondary Education Board 
Professor SM Kamal Uddin Haider. 

The seven models of non-programmable scientific calculators are FX-100MS, FX-
991EA, FX-570MS, FX-82MS, FX-991EX, FX-991MS and FX-991ES plus.

Additionally, the candidates are permitted to use a normal category 
calculator in the upcoming examinations.
